Constructing Weight Multisets#
In this section, we describe how to construct weight multisets.
- TrivialLieRepresentationDecomposition(R): RootDtm -> LieRepDec#
- LieRepresentationDecomposition(R): RootDtm -> LieRepDec#
The decomposition multiset of the trivial representation. The root datum \(R\) must be weakly simply connected.
- LieRepresentationDecomposition(R, v): RootDtm, ModTupRngElt -> LieRepDec#
- LieRepresentationDecomposition(R, v): RootDtm, SeqEnum -> LieRepDec#
The decomposition multiset of the highest weight representation with weight \(v\), i.e., the singleton multiset. The root datum \(R\) must be weakly simply connected. The weight \(v\) must be a sequence of length \(d\) or an element of \({\mathbb{Z}}^d\), where \(d\) is the dimension of the root datum \(R\).
- LieRepresentationDecomposition(R, Wt, Mp): RootDtm, SeqEnum, SeqEnum -> LieRepDec#
The decomposition multiset with weights given by the sequence \(Wt\) and multiplicities given by of the sequence \(Mp\). The root datum \(R\) must be weakly simply connected. The weights must be a sequences of length \(d\) or elements of \({\mathbb{Z}}^d\), where \(d\) is the dimension of the root datum \(R\).
- AdjointRepresentationDecomposition(R): RootDtm -> LieRepDec#
The decomposition multiset of the adjoint representation. This has the highest root of \(R\) as its highest weight with multiplicity one. The root datum \(R\) must be weakly simply connected.
- Example: Adjoint Representation (ex-e0259e)#
The adjoint representation:
> R := RootDatum("D4" : Isogeny := "SC"); > D := AdjointRepresentationDecomposition(R); > D:Maximal; Highest weight decomposition of representation of: R: Simply connected root datum of dimension 4 of type D4 Dimension of weight space:4 Weights: [ (0 1 0 0) ] Multiplicities: [ 1 ] > HighestRoot(R : Basis := "Weight"); (0 1 0 0)
